Все сервисы Хабра
Сообщество IT-специалистов
Ответы на любые вопросы об IT
Профессиональное развитие в IT
Закрыть
Задать вопрос
skasochnoebali
@skasochnoebali
Вёрстка
Как сделать чтобы при нажатии на кнопку затемнялась вся страница сайта?
Как сделать чтобы при нажатии на кнопку затемнялась вся страница сайта?
Вопрос задан
более трёх лет назад
347 просмотров
1
комментарий
Подписаться
1
Простой
1
комментарий
Facebook
Вконтакте
Twitter
sergski
@sergski
Размещаете div на всю ширину/высоту, черным фоном, полупрозрачностью и display: none. По клику по кнопке у вашего div делаете display: block; и не забудьте кнопку закрыть, которая вернут ему none;
Написано
более трёх лет назад
Решения вопроса
0
Пригласить эксперта
Ответы на вопрос
1
Ragtime Kitty
@Ragtime_Kitty
Сделать черный оверлей, установить прозрачность на 0. По клику на кнопку увеличивать прозрачность до нужной степени "темноты"
snippet
Ответ написан
более трёх лет назад
3
комментария
Нравится
2
3
комментария
Facebook
Вконтакте
Twitter
poniyur
@poniyur
Только если это просто затемнить сайт, то ещё этому оверлею добавить pointer-events: none; в стили
Написано
более трёх лет назад
Ragtime Kitty
@Ragtime_Kitty
poniyur
, там так и есть
Написано
более трёх лет назад
poniyur
@poniyur
Ragtime_Kitty
, упс не заметил)
Написано
более трёх лет назад
Ваш ответ на вопрос
Войдите, чтобы написать ответ
Войти через центр авторизации
Похожие вопросы
HTML
+1 ещё
Средний
Как правильно сочетать теги article, section и заголовки h1-h6?
2 подписчика
21 сент.
181 просмотр
2
ответа
HTML
+2 ещё
Простой
Что поменять/добавить чтобы отображались все подкасты (видео)?
1 подписчик
26 авг.
138 просмотров
0
ответов
CSS
+2 ещё
Простой
Вёрстка анимированой кнопки — как реализовать?
1 подписчик
22 авг.
206 просмотров
1
ответ
Вёрстка
Простой
Проблема с версткой сайта?
1 подписчик
20 авг.
694 просмотра
2
ответа
HTML
+3 ещё
Простой
Как отменить инвертирование текста в yandex почте в dark mode?
2 подписчика
19 авг.
219 просмотров
0
ответов
CSS
+2 ещё
Простой
Как сделать такую сетку?
2 подписчика
28 июл.
2786 просмотров
2
ответа
CSS
+3 ещё
Средний
Яндекс Браузер на MacOS: как убрать или подвинуть иконку автозаполнения?
1 подписчик
25 июл.
122 просмотра
0
ответов
Вёрстка
Средний
Как создать эффект для активной кнопки?
1 подписчик
09 июл.
148 просмотров
1
ответ
Вёрстка
Простой
TG Mini App Full screen отступ от выреза?
2 подписчика
05 июл.
288 просмотров
1
ответ
CSS
+1 ещё
Простой
Как сделать чтобы блок с border-dashed постепенно заполнялся border-solid?
2 подписчика
28 июн.
1155 просмотров
1
ответ
Показать ещё
Загружается…
Вакансии с Хабр Карьеры
Руководитель группы разработки удаленно или в офис
IT Force
До 7 000 $
Разработчик фронтенда на TypeScript Middle+ / Senior в аналитический стартап
ТОРГСТАТ
от 200 000 до 300 000 ₽
Fullstack разработчик (Laravel + Vue.js/React.js)
Nomadic Soft
от 1 600 до 2 240 $
Минуточку внимания
Войдите на сайт
Чтобы задать вопрос и получить на него квалифицированный ответ.
Войти через центр авторизации
Закрыть
Реклама